TRANSPOSE(3G) [FIXME: manual] TRANSPOSE(3G)

transpose - calculate the transpose of a matrix

mat2 transpose(mat2 m);

mat3 transpose(mat3 m);

mat4 transpose(mat4 m);

mat2x3 transpose(mat3x2 m);

mat2x4 transpose(mat4x2 m);

mat3x2 transpose(mat2x3 m);

mat3x4 transpose(mat4x3 m);

mat4x2 transpose(mat2x4 m);

mat4x3 transpose(mat3x4 m);

dmat2 transpose(dmat2 m);

dmat3 transpose(dmat3 m);

dmat4 transpose(dmat4 m);

dmat2x3 transpose(dmat3x2 m);

dmat2x4 transpose(dmat4x2 m);

dmat3x2 transpose(dmat2x3 m);

dmat3x4 transpose(dmat4x3 m);

dmat4x2 transpose(dmat2x4 m);

dmat4x3 transpose(dmat3x4 m);

m

Specifies the matrix of which to take the transpose.

transpose returns the transpose of the matrix m.

OpenGL Shading Language Version
Function Name 1.10 1.20 1.30 1.40 1.50 3.30 4.00 4.10 4.20 4.30 4.40 4.50
transpose (float) -
transpose (double) - - - - - -

determinant(), inverse()

Copyright © 2011-2014 Khronos Group. This material may be distributed subject to the terms and conditions set forth in the Open Publication License, v 1.0, 8 June 1999. http://opencontent.org/openpub/.

Copyright © 2011-2014 Khronos Group

05/21/2022 [FIXME: source]